Native VLAN for bridge mode virtual APs (frames on
the native VLAN are not tagged with 802.1q tags).
Shows the access control list (ACL) applied on the
uplink of a remote AP.
DNS name used by the corporate network.
SNMP system contact information.
Maximum Transmission Unit (MTU) size, in bytes.
This value describes the greatest amount of data
that can be transferred in one physical frame.
The IP address of the local management switch
(LMS)—the Dell controller which is responsible for
terminating user traffic from the APs, and
processing and forwarding the traffic to the wired
network.
NOTE: If the LMS-IP is blank, the access point will
remain on the controller that it finds using methods
like DNS or DHCP. If an IP address is configured for
the LMS IP parameter, the AP will be immediately
redirected to the controller at that address.
For multi-controller networks, this parameter
displays the IP address of a backup to the IP
address specified with the lms-ip parameter.
In multi-controller ipv6 networks, this parameter
specifies the IPv6 address of the local management
switch (LMS)—the Dell controller—which is
responsible for terminating user traffic from the APs,
and processing and forwarding the traffic to the
wired network. This can be the IP address of the
local or master controller.
In multi-controller ipv6 networks, this parameter
specifies the IPv6 address of a backup to the IPv6
address specified with the LMS IPv6 setting.
